无码专区 Tops Texas Schools with 98.52% First-Time Bar Passage Rate

无码专区 Dedman School of Law alumni achieved a first-time bar passage rate of 98.52% on the July 2025 Texas Bar Exam, ranking the school first in the state among all law schools and marking the fourth straight year the school has improved its passage rate year over year.
Since 2022, Dedman Law’s first-time passage rate has increased 12 points from 86.59%.

First-Time Bar Passage Rate in Texas for July 2025:
- 无码专区 (98.52%)
- Baylor (96.59%)
- University of Texas (96.00%)
- Texas Tech (95.97%)
- Texas A&M (95.33%)
- South Texas (91.67%)
- Houston (89.50%)
- St. Mary’s (84.54%)
- University of North Texas (82.83%)
- Texas Southern University (66.33%)
According to , July’s results mark the first time in more than two decades where Texas law students taking the July bar exam for the first time earned a passage rate of more than 90%. When all first-time takers of the Texas bar are considered, the pass rate was 84.11%, giving Dedman Law a differential of 14.41% (or, the difference between Dedman Law's passage rate and the overall bar passage rate, which is heavily considered as part of the U.S. News & World Report Law School rankings process).
“Texas law school students taking the bar exam for the first time in July passed at a rate of 90.67% compared to 84.11% for first-time examinees overall. This year's pass rate for Texas law students bested last year's rate of 88.67%, according to statistics released Wednesday by the Texas Board of Law Examiners,” the article stated.
